Collector Grade autographed, signed memorabilia: Danny DeVito 8x10 Hoffa photo, BAS authenticated. Danny DeVito is an Emmy and Golden Globe winner who became a household name on Taxi. He directed and co-starred in Hoffa (1992) opposite Jack Nicholson, and later earned cult status with roles in Batman Returns, Twins, Matilda, and It's Always Sunny in Philadelphia.

Authenticated by Beckett, a respected name in the hobby, this verified authentic signature includes an affixed BAS sticker with a QR code for online verification (Beckett no longer issues separate serial-numbered COA cards; the sticker is the full authentication).
